Exploring Professional Dent Repair
PDR is a sophisticated process designed to repair minor dents and dings from vehicle bodywork while preserving the vehicle's paint finish. This technique requires specific instruments to precisely massage the damaged area to its factory condition. The instruments are crafted to reach behind the damaged panel, facilitating exact correction while preserving the finish.
You'll find this approach ideal for small to medium-sized dents, particularly those produced by hail damage, ball impacts, or light bumps.
When comparing costs, PDR typically stands out the more economical choice in comparison with traditional dent repair approaches. Traditional repair techniques usually require sanding, filling, and repainting, which not only costs more in labor but could potentially harm the factory paint finish.
In contrast, PDR preserves the original paint and needs considerably less material and time. This creates a reduced overall cost and frequently a quicker turnaround. By choosing PDR, you're selecting a repair method that eliminates potential decreases in your vehicle's resale value resulting from mismatched paint or visible filler materials.

What Types of Damage Are Repairable?
Many car owners often question the extent of damage paintless dent repair (PDR) can effectively fix. It's important to recognize that this approach is highly effective in fixing minor to moderate dent damage, specifically when the paint hasn't been damaged.
PDR works best for fixing small dings that usually occur due to routine accidents such as cart impacts or flying debris. This approach also works exceptionally well for addressing crease damage, which are usually more difficult as a result of the distorted surface.
In addition, PDR is the preferred approach for addressing hail damage, which can result in many dents on your vehicle's exterior. Given that these dents usually don't damage the paint layer, they will be smoothly corrected using PDR, maintaining your car's initial finish.
You'll check here discover PDR particularly valuable for fixing parking lot damage, which commonly happen in parking lots. Unlike conventional repair methods that might require sanding, filler, or repainting, PDR operates by precisely massaging the damaged area back to its original condition, making certain no trace of the damage remains.
When it comes to surface dents in which the paint remains undamaged, PDR is able to return your car's look without the hassles of traditional repair methods.
How Our Expert Technicians Work
Our skilled technicians begin the paintless dent repair (PDR) process by comprehensively evaluating the scope of the damage on your vehicle. They precisely examine each dent, reviewing its size, depth, and location to determine the most appropriate repair method. This initial step is crucial as it dictates the specific dent repair techniques that'll be implemented.
After completing the evaluation, our skilled technicians employ their years of experience to skillfully approach the dent from beneath. They could disconnect panels or trim to reach the affected area from behind. With purpose-built instruments, they then skillfully manipulate the metal to its factory shape from the reverse side. This technique is exact and demands a careful touch and a thorough knowledge of metal properties.

How Does Paintless Dent Repair Influence Your Car's Market Value?
Paintless dent repair doesn't impact your vehicle's resale value.
Actually, this process generally protects it by keeping the initial paint and body state. This method repairs dents without needing repainting or filler, which can be telltale signs of previous damage to prospective purchasers.
It's an ideal solution when you want to keeping your car in excellent condition for future sale, as it keeps the surface looking untouched and original.
